Talk therapy

In a 1:1 conversational setting, we explore the problems and situations that bother you.

My approach is inspired by Cognitive Behavioural Therapy. Behaviours, emotions and attitude to life are often strongly dependent on our thoughts (cognitions). Changing the way you think and behave often leads to new perspectives and makes negative feelings disappear.

         By changing the way you look at things, the things you look at change - Wayne Dyer

Mindfulness (the ability to become aware of your thoughts, feelings, sensations and the physical environment without the need to judge) and meditation techniques are part of my approach. We can explore this field if this feels relevant to you.
